Upload
builiem
View
217
Download
1
Embed Size (px)
Citation preview
BAB - 01
Arsitektur Komputer
• Rini Agustina, S.Kom, M.Pd
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 1
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ER
Arsitektur Komputer Vs Organisasi Komputer
•Arsitektur Komputer adalah bagian yang lebih cenderung padakajian atribut–atribut sistem komputer yang terkait denganseorang programmer. Contohnya, set instruksi, aritmetika yangdigunakan, teknik pengalamatan, mekanisme I/O.
•Organisasi Komputer adalah bagian yang terkait erat denganunit–unit operasional dan interkoneksi antar komponen penyusunsistem komputer dalam merealisasikan aspek arsitekturalnya.Contoh aspek organisasional adalah teknologi hardware, perangkatantarmuka, teknologi memori, sistem memori, dan sinyal–sinyalkontrol.
2
3
Struktur dan Fungsi Komputer Struktur
adalah susunan yang menggambarkan hubungan antar komponen dalamsebuah sistem.Contoh- Sebuah komputer memiliki struktur CPU, Main Memory , I/O dan Bus- Sebuah Magnetic Disk memiliki struktur alamat yang terdiri dari Track danSector .
Fungsiadalah operasi yang bisa dilakukan oleh komponen komponen sebuahsistem, Contoh:-Komputer memiliki fungsi Pemrosesan Data, Pemindahan Data,Penyimpanan Data dan Pengendalian.
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 3
4
Struktur Dasar KomputerTerdapat empat struktur utama:
1. Central Processing Unit (CPU), berfungsi sebagai pengontroloperasi komputer dan pusat pengolahan fungsi – fungsikomputer.
2. Main Memory , berfungsi sebagai penyimpan data.
3. I/O, berfungsi memindahkan data dari/ke lingkungan luar atauperangkat lainnya.
4. System Interconnection, berfungsi sebagai sistem yangmenghubungkan CPU, memori utama dan I/O.
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 4
5
Diagram Struktur Dasar Komputer
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 5
FAKULTAS TEKNOLOGI INFORMASI 6
CPU : Struktur Dasar
Ada 3 bagian
1. Control Unit, berfungsi untuk mengontrol operasi CPU danmengontrol komputer secara keseluruhan.
2. Arithmetic And Logic Unit (ALU), berfungsi untukmembentuk fungsi-fungsi pengolahan data komputer.
3. Register, berfungsi sebagai penyimpan internal bagi CPU.
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 6
FAKULTAS TEKNOLOGI INFORMASI 7
CPU : Diagram Struktur Dasar
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 7
FAKULTAS TEKNOLOGI INFORMASI 8
Control Unit : Struktur DasarAda 3 bagian
1. Squencing Logic , adalah bagian yang berfungsi untukmenangani sinyal-sinyal pengendali, seperti sinyal: Clock ,Read/Write , Interrupt Request
2. Register & Decoder, adalah bagian yang berfungsi untukmelakukan “decoding” atau penterjemahan sandi instruksi agardapat segera di eksekusi.
3. Control Memory adalah bagian yang digunakan oleh ControlUnit untuk menyimpan parameter parameter pengendalian.
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 8
FAKULTAS TEKNOLOGI INFORMASI 9
Control Unit : Diagram Struktur Dasar
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 9
FAKULTAS TEKNOLOGI INFORMASI 10
Fungsi Dasar Sistem Komputer
Pada prinsipnya terdapat 4 fungsi operasi, yaitu :
•1. Fungsi Operasi Pengolahan Data (Data Processing)
•2. Fungsi Operasi Penyimpanan Data (Data Storage)
•3. Fungsi Operasi Pemindahan Data (Data Movement)
•4. Fungsi Operasi Kontrol (Control)
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 10
FAKULTAS TEKNOLOGI INFORMASI 11
Komputer harus dapat memproses data. Representasi data di sini bermacam–macam, akan tetapi nantinya data harus disesuaikan dengan mesinpemrosesnya. Dalam pengolahan data,
Komputer memerlukan unit penyimpanan sehingga diperlukan suatu fungsiPenyimpanan data. Walaupun hasil komputer digunakan saat itu, setidaknyakomputer memerlukan media penyimpanan untuk data prosesnya.
Dalam interaksi dengan dunia luar sebagai fungsi Pemindahan datadiperlukan antarmuka (interface), proses ini dilakukan oleh unit Input/Output(I/O) dan perangkatnya disebut peripheral. Saat interaksi dengan perpindahandata yang jauh atau dari remote device, komputer melakukan proseskomunikasi data.
Fungsi Pengendalian juga dilakukan oleh komputer, baik pengendalianinternal dalam komputer itu sendiri maupun pengendalian eksternal , yaitupengendalian peralatan lain.
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 11
FAKULTAS TEKNOLOGI INFORMASI 12
Diagram Fungsi Komputer
Ada 4 bagian
1. Data Movement Apparatusmerupakan “interface” untukpemindahan data
2. Data Storage Facilitymerupakan unit penyimpan data
3. Data Processing Facilitymerupakan unit untuk pemrosesan data
4. Control Mechanismmerupakan pengendali utama fungsikomputer
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 12
FAKULTAS TEKNOLOGI INFORMASI 13
Fungsi Pengolahan Data (1)
Langkah-Langkah
1. Data diambil dari Storage olehControl
2. Control memberikan ke bagianProcessing untuk diolah
3. Hasil olahan pada bagian Processingkemudian disimpan kembali keStorage sebagai sebuah “result”
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 13
FAKULTAS TEKNOLOGI INFORMASI 14
Fungsi Pengolahan Data (2)
Langkah-Langkah
1. Data diambil dari Data MovementApparatus oleh Control
2. Control memberikanya ke bagianProcessing untuk diolah
3. Hasil olahan pada bagian Processingkemudian disimpan ke Storagesebagai sebuah “result”Sebaliknya…… Data dari Storagediambil oleh control utk diolah,setelah itu hasilnya ke DataMovement Apparatus
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 14
FAKULTAS TEKNOLOGI INFORMASI 15
Fungsi Data Storage
Langkah-langkah
1. Data dari Data MovementApparatus dipindahkan olehControl untuk di “save” keMemory Storage
2. Sebaliknya , data dari memoryStorage dipindahkan olehControl untuk di “write” ke DataMovement Apparatus
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 15
FAKULTAS TEKNOLOGI INFORMASI 16
Fungsi Data Movement
Langkah-Langkah
Data yang berasal dari DataMovement Apparatus olehControl kemudian di kirimkembali ke bagian DataMovement Apparatus yang lain
Konsep Arsitektur Komputer
RINI AGUSTINA - DARIBERBAGAI SUMBER 16
RINI AGUSTINA - DARIBERBAGAI SUMBER
SEE U NEXT WEEK
Konsep Arsitektur Komputer
17